One of Australia’s classiest young entertainers, singer and piano player Frances Madden and Band, return to Brisbane's Doo-Bop Jazz Bar for a dazzling dinner show on Friday, June 21, 2019.

Described as Australia's rising star of jazz, blues and ballads, this talented pianist, singer and songwriter plays to sold-out shows at leading jazz venues and festivals around Australia. She has also supported international artists on tour including Dionne Warwick and Grammy Award-winner Gregory Porter.

According to jazz legend James Morrison, “Frances has a wonderful feeling for jazz and blues standards but what makes her a real stand-out are her original songs and her unique style.”

For one night only at Doo-Bop, Frances will captivate the audience with her genuine, warm stage presence as she performs a mix of her own enchanting blues, ballads and swing, as well as timeless classics in her unique style; together with a stellar, six-piece line-up including some of Brisbane’s best jazz musicians.

Nice to know - Frances' soon-to-be released second album of predominantly original tunes, will without doubt help bring jazz-influenced music back into the mainstream. The album has been produced by ARIA Award-winner Chong Lim AM, who also produces for John Farnham, Olivia Newton-John and David Campbell.

Need to know - Doors open at 6:30pm, show starts at 8pm
